Description
The U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A), Center for Devices and Radiological Health (CDRH), has a requirement for one complete, off-the-shelf Pulsed Field Ablation (PFA) system for use in a non-clinical research environment. The required system includes a PFA generator, five compatible clinical PFA catheters, all required accessories, cables, connectors, applicable software and licenses, setup/startup assistance, functional testing, training, warranty coverage, and technical support, in accordance with Attachment 1 Statement of Work (SOW). Questions are due Thursday, August 27, 2026, at 10:30 a.m. ET. Offers are due Thursday, September 3, 2026, at 2:30 p.m. ET.
